Netflix announced the date of the release Squid game‘s Very expected, the third and last season.
Season 3 of Current South Korean drama hit the first show on June 27.
The news comes a month after the series-which is witnessing 456 individuals who suffer from financial distress competing in children’s games or death to get an opportunity to change life from money-leaving fans in the Cliffhangir climate season.
The last two seasons were filmed back, so it was confirmed that there is a much shorter waiting period between them than a three -year break between the first two.
The creator has already expressed the creator Hwang Dong-Hyuk his hesitation in continuing the presentation story to what is not his first season in 2021, admitting that the “money” he convinced of doing this.
“Although the first series was a great global success, I honestly did not do much,” he told the BBC. “So, doing the second series will help compensate me for the success of the first as well.”
The second batch, which appeared on December 26, 2024, welcomes the return of 456/Gi-Hun (Lee Jung-Jae), which re-introduces the game to try to close it forever.
While the second season impressed the critics and viewers with a new group of characters and stories, its division -filled conclusion proved because it asked how it ended on such a main slope.
“Of course, those who watch,” Oh, no. What will happen next? Huang admitted in an interview with the next episode now Entertainment weekly. “But I think that because, at that moment, Gi-HUN loses everything, fails in all his attempts [to stop the games]This is when it passes through the transfer of another personality. So I thought this was the best place to finish the season. “
He explained that he originally planned to write the story of the second season over about eight to nine episodes, but “as soon as I finished the story, it came to more than 10 episodes, which I thought was very long in one season.”
“So I wanted to get enough point where I can give the closure as a second season and then move forward with the third,” he said.
